Transaction 556e603110fbaa418e97ea9ae907584e25c2a61578d808624e2870eedbbd26d5
1 Input
1 Output
-
556e603110fbaa418e97ea9ae907584e25c2a61578d808624e2870eedbbd26d5:0
- value
- 499938979
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d6aa58b8c922775b82c4ecdc09baeee9b32eb9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1599AaC4JeMVF4HnxY4iym7mekTx9DqXpN